卸载 gvfs samba 共享并打开文件

卸载 gvfs samba 共享并打开文件

我已安装 Samba 共享。我正尝试在命令行上卸载它。

$ gvfs-mount -u smb://server/root/
Error unmounting mount: Filesystem is busy

我运行lsof查找打开的文件,但我不知道需要终止哪个 PID。它没有说smb://server/root/my-open-file。我如何找出要终止哪个 PID?

答案1

lsof -i -a username | grep ^gvfs

-i
仅列出网络连接(更多选项请参阅手册页)

-a 用户名
仅列出特定用户打开的文件

grep ^gvfs
仅列出由 gvfs 打开的文件

相关内容